Works great with BMW ICOM series (ICOM, ICOM A2, ICOM A3, ICOM Next)
http://blog.obd2diy.fr/2017/06/06/icom-next-a-vs-icom-a3-vs-icom-a2-vs-icom-a/

ICOM A: the first generation of BMW ICOM, but kind of out of date

ICOM A2: the most populous, coding/programming works perfect

ICOM A3: it’s a modified ICOM A2 for vehicles with OBD access receives a significantly more powerful processor and more storage capacity. And robust aluminium case will help to avoid damage when using in harsh environments. It works better in cooling, runs faster and works more stable, not easier broken than older ICOM A.

ICOM Next: best for BMW coding/programming even on the future cars, much faster in BMW F and G series .. supports gigabit Ethernet too to be future proof, there currently is not gigabit Ethernet protocol defined yet for autos. Also it has USB3.0 instead of USB2.0 and a better wifi card.
